an ambush "Put busshementis to the citye bihynde it," Wyclif. Literally a weaver, a lier in wait, from arab, to weave = "nectere insidias, struere dolos."

for the city behind it High up, probably in the main ravine between Ai and Bethel. "Ai must be somewhere between Michmash and Rimmon, a region greatly cut up with gorges and ravines; and as I passed from Beit-în toward Michmash, I could easily understand how Joshua's ambush of 5000 men could lie hid between Ai and Bethel." Thomson's Land and the Book, p. 671.
